Output e28eb84a84aaebecd5ce0cde685b768efa493ca4e044020ee4cd084fc3a0c5f2:0

value
590346
script pubkey
OP_0 OP_PUSHBYTES_20 264586603a842f083e41efffc9303e9f0e9e3b1f
address
bc1qyezcvcp6sshss0jpallujvp7nu8fuwclqmx0s6
transaction
e28eb84a84aaebecd5ce0cde685b768efa493ca4e044020ee4cd084fc3a0c5f2
confirmations
224049
spent
true